Tsala Treetop Lodge – A Luxurious South African Lodge

A luxury resort in a beautiful, indigenous forest on the coast of South Africa, Tsala Treetop Lodge sits at the start of the Garden Route (between Plettenberg and Kynsna) and is the perfect setting to begin an African adventure.

It proudly boasts a small number of boutique treetop rooms and suites where the stunning interiors come a close second only to the 360 degree views of the forest around.

The Afro-Indian design is sumptuous and sophisticated and the dark wood and tactile, heavy textiles sit wonderfully amidst the treetops around them. A small resort of only 10 suites (sleep two guests) and 6 villas (sleep four guests), each is totally surrounded and secluded by its own canopy in the forest.

Guests navigate the resort along tree-top walkways linking the welcome reception, the suites and the restaurants with al fresco dining.

Our villa was the perfect luxury hide-away: Tsala is very grown-up camping indeed. The deck which leads to the villa is home to the guests’ own infinity pool, apparently running out into the forest.

A strange but marvellous feeling to bathe in, these pools are totally suspended above the ground and look directly into the habitat of the monkeys and beautiful native birds.

The suite comprises of a lounge, bedroom, bathroom and al fresco shower room, all of which face the forest, and all offer spectacular floor-to-ceiling windows from which to enjoy the view.

The lounge also opens to a sun-facing terrace so at all times in your Tsala suite you feel connected to the habitat. It’s from the bathroom that we spot our first monkeys, and during an outside shower they curiously appear to be watching from the branches.

Tsala’s restaurant served up an excellent dinner, and when you learn that herbs, fruits and vegetables are all sourced from Tsala’s beautifully rich gardens, you begin to understand the attention to detail that has created this wonderful restaurant.

Guests sit amongst modern, African interiors overlooking the gardens and a spectacular sunset throughout dinner. Make sure you save time for a digestif next to the log fire outside too – blankets are provided and the excellent wine and drinks list make for the perfect end to a pretty wonderful evening.

Tsala Treetop Lodge welcomes children over the age of ten only, and with a serious wine cellar and very proud sommeliers, this resort provides a sophisticated Jungle experience. An absolute treat, the views, the staff and the atmosphere make Tsala Treetop Lodge a very special place indeed.
